Warriors' Draymond Green bought Andre Iguodala's new book at airport

Share

Draymond Green is getting on a plane and going on a long trip.

So, what better way to pass the time than to buy a good book and read it on the flight?

That's exactly what the Warriors All-Star forward did Thursday night.

That's right. Draymond bought teammate Andre Iguodala's new book, "The Sixth Man," in an airport.

This isn't the first time the Warriors have had some fun at Iguodala's expense in an airport.

After the Warriors beat the Toronto Raptors in Game 2 of the 2019 NBA Finals, DeMarcus Cousins and Iguodala were pushed to the team plane in wheelchairs.

Cousins documented it on his Instagram Story.
